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
The power consumption level in the lowest power mode which cannot be switched off (influenced) by the user and that may persist for an indefinite time when the appliance is connected to the main electricity supply and used in accordance with the manufacturer’s instructions. 4, record 1, English, - standby%20mode

Record 3, Textual support, English
Record number: 3, Textual support number: 1 CONT
The containment system is considered to be in a standby mode during normal reactor conditions. It is kept in a state of continual readiness for immediate response if called upon to act in the functional mode. 1, record 3, English, - standby%20mode
